Table of Budget-Friendly Accommodations

We’ve put together a table comparing prices, amenities, and services of budget-friendly hotels, hostels, and guesthouses in Belize. Take a look:

| Accommodation Type | Price Range | Amenities | Services |
| — | — | — | — |
| Budget Hotel | $20-$50 per night | Private bathroom, Wi-Fi, TV | Laundry, tour bookings |
| Hostel | $10-$30 per night | Shared bathroom, dorm rooms, Wi-Fi | Kitchen facilities, communal lounge |
| Guesthouse | $30-$60 per night | Private bathroom, balcony, Wi-Fi | Breakfast, laundry, tour bookings |
| Eco-Lodge | $50-$100 per night | Private bathroom, jungle views, Wi-Fi | Guided tours, wildlife viewing |

Alternative Accommodation Options

If you’re looking for something a bit different, consider these alternative accommodation options:

– Vacation Rentals: Rent a private beachfront villa or a cozy cabin in the jungle. Prices vary depending on location and amenities, but you can often find deals for under $100 per night.
– Airbnb: Book a room or apartment in a local’s home for a truly immersive experience. Prices start at around $20 per night, but be sure to read reviews and check the location before booking.
– Camping: If you’re feeling adventurous, pitch a tent at one of Belize’s many campsites. Prices start at around $10 per night, but be prepared for basic amenities.

In-depth information for Vacation Rentals: For example, a 2-bedroom beachfront villa in Ambergris Caye can cost around $800 per week, which works out to approximately $115 per night. You’ll get access to a private pool, beach towels, and a fully equipped kitchen.

In-depth information for Airbnb: For example, a private room in a local’s home in San Ignacio can cost around $20 per night. You’ll get to experience the authentic Belizean lifestyle and enjoy homemade meals prepared by your host.

In-depth information for Camping: For example, a campsite in the Cayo District offers basic amenities like toilets and showers for around $10 per night. You’ll be surrounded by lush jungle and have opportunities to spot rare wildlife.

What is the best time to visit Belize?

The best time to visit Belize depends on your preferences, but generally, the dry season from December to April is the most popular time to visit. During this time, the weather is dry and sunny, making it ideal for outdoor activities like snorkeling and diving.

How do I get to Belize?

The most common way to get to Belize is by flying into Philip S. W. Goldson International Airport (BZE) in Belize City. You can also take a bus or shuttle from nearby countries like Mexico or Guatemala.

What language is spoken in Belize?

English is the official language of Belize, but you may also hear Kriol (a Creole language) and Spanish spoken in various locations.
